What is the fuel economy of the Lamborghini Aventador?

The Lamborghini Aventador is a supercar with a big engine, which means it doesn’t save much fuel 🚗. Its fuel economy is generally around 10 miles per gallon in the city and about 15 miles per gallon on the highway, depending on the model and how you drive it 🚧.

When driving on highways, some versions like the Aventador S can get up to 18 miles per gallon, but in the city, it’s usually around 11 miles per gallon, which is not very efficient compared to regular cars 🚗.

The Aventador uses premium gasoline because it has a powerful V12 engine that needs high-quality fuel to run well ⛽️.

Overall, the Aventador is not a car for people who worry about saving money on fuel, but it’s great for those who love speed and style 🏎️.
